The GUI was a lottery type of thing. You could input some amount of karma <= your total karma and gamble it (apparently "gamble" is censored, like wtf). The more karma you input the more likely you were to get a card (the ones Autumn posted). The cards either gave you karma, took more karma away, or had a special function like entitling you to have your own board on WU that you controlled/were a mod on. You could then post all the cards you'd received through the lottery on WU and I would run it through a program that told me how much karma to give/take from you and what special bonuses to give to you.
If I'm honest I could release the Java version, but I'm embarrassed at how hacky it is. It was my first major project and the code is pretty bad. I could make it much cleaner (both the GUI and the file I/O) now.
